A Refined Measurement of Aerodynamic Pressures over Progressive Water Waves.

Abstract

Improved pressure sensing and wave following systems for the investigation of the characteristics of the turbulent air stream in the vicinity of air-water interface were developed. A reappraisal of Miles' inviscid theory was made. A carefully controlled experiment designed to match assumptions was performed by using the newly developed systems. The wave-induced pressure signal was extracted by using a waveform educator. The result, in terms of both pressure magnitude and phase angle, was summarized with the experimental results of others to compare with Miles' inviscid theory. (Author)
